Fotograf bada zdjęcia w swoim miejscu pracy

Skuteczna kompresja zdjęć JPG – jak zmniejszyć wagę plików graficznych?

6 min. czytania

W erze szybkiego internetu i mobilnego dostępu do treści, kompresja zdjęć JPG stała się nieodzownym elementem optymalizacji stron internetowych, blogów i mediów społecznościowych.

Pliki graficzne, zwłaszcza format JPEG, często zajmują najwięcej miejsca i spowalniają ładowanie witryn, co obniża konwersję i widoczność w Google. Zmniejszenie rozmiaru zdjęć nawet o kilkadziesiąt procent bez zauważalnej utraty jakości realnie przyspiesza stronę i poprawia doświadczenie użytkownika.

Czym jest kompresja obrazów i dlaczego JPG wymaga szczególnej uwagi?

Kompresja obrazów to redukcja rozmiaru plików graficznych poprzez usuwanie zbędnych danych lub ich uproszczenie. Wyróżniamy dwa główne typy: stratną (lossy) i bezstratną (lossless). Kompresja stratna usuwa nieodwracalnie część informacji, znacząco ograniczając wagę pliku, a bezstratna zachowuje pełną wierność kosztem mniejszych oszczędności.

Format JPEG (Joint Photographic Experts Group) dominuje w fotografii dzięki wydajnej kompresji opartej na transformacji kosinusowej (DCT), kwantyzacji i kodowaniu entropijnym. Obsługuje 24-bitową paletę kolorów, dlatego świetnie sprawdza się w zdjęciach realistycznych. Praktyczne ustawienie jakości to 70–85%, które zapewnia korzystny balans między wagą pliku a jakością wizualną.

Nieoptymalizowane obrazy potrafią stanowić nawet 70% rozmiaru strony i opóźniać jej ładowanie o całe sekundy. Google premiuje szybkie witryny, a użytkownicy szybciej porzucają wolne strony. W 2026 roku – przy dominacji urządzeń mobilnych – optymalizacja JPG to absolutna podstawa.

Metody kompresji JPG – stratna vs. bezstratna

Kompresja stratna – maksymalne oszczędności

W kompresji stratnej algorytmy usuwają mniej istotne dane (np. subtelne gradienty). Dla JPG standardowo stosuje się próbkowanie chrominancji 4:2:0, które znacząco redukuje dane o kolorze, oraz kompresję progresywną, gdzie obraz ładuje się warstwowo, poprawiając percepcję szybkości.

Zalecenie: ustaw jakość na 70–85% w edytorze graficznym – to optymalny kompromis dla zdjęć o dużej liczbie kolorów.

Kompresja bezstratna – dla perfekcjonistów

Bezstratna kompresja nie traci żadnych danych – po dekompresji obraz jest identyczny z oryginałem. Popularne algorytmy to Deflate (LZ77 + Huffman) czy LZW; w JPG stosowane rzadziej niż w PNG, lecz w trybach lossless potrafią zmniejszyć plik o 10–30% bez zmian wizualnych.

Porównanie metod kompresji JPG

Poniższa tabela zestawia różnice, by ułatwić dobór odpowiedniej metody do zastosowania:

Metoda Oszczędność rozmiaru Utrata jakości Zastosowanie
Stratna (70–85%) Do 90% Minimalna Strony WWW, social media
Bezstratna 10–30% Brak Archiwa, druki profesjonalne
Progresywna Zmienna Jak stratna Szybkie ładowanie online

Nowoczesne formaty alternatywne dla JPG – WebP i AVIF

Choć skupiamy się na JPG, w wielu przypadkach warto przejść na nowsze formaty zapewniające lepszą kompresję przy tej samej jakości:

  • WebP – wykorzystuje techniki z VP8 (predykcja międzyblokowa, kodowanie entropijne), zwykle daje pliki o 25–30% mniejsze od JPG przy tej samej jakości; obsługuje przezroczystość i animacje;
  • AVIF – najefektywniejszy w testach, oferuje najmniejsze pliki, wsparcie HDR i szeroką paletę barw; świetny wybór dla zastosowań high‑end.

Konwertuj JPG do WebP/AVIF w narzędziach online i zachowaj kompatybilność dzięki fallbackowi do JPG dla starszych przeglądarek.

Najlepsze narzędzia do kompresji JPG – przegląd i testy

Rynek narzędzi jest bogaty – od darmowych online po wtyczki CMS. Oto najskuteczniejsze rozwiązania potwierdzone testami:

Narzędzia online (darmowe i proste)

Jeśli zależy Ci na łatwej, szybkiej i często hurtowej optymalizacji, sprawdź te serwisy:

  • TinyPNG/TinyJPG – specjalista od JPG/PNG; szybka kompresja zbiorcza i brak widocznej utraty jakości; idealne dla dużych bibliotek;
  • Compressor.io – obsługuje JPG, PNG, GIF, SVG; tryby lossy/lossless i podgląd przed/po; bardzo prosta obsługa;
  • Kraken.io – tryby stratny, bezstratny i ekspercki; dostępne API i wtyczki WordPress/Magento; darmowy limit 100 MB;
  • ShortPixel – topowe wyniki (do ~86% kompresji JPG); tryby Glossy/Lossy/Lossless, do 50 plików naraz; wtyczka WP, 100 obrazów/mies. za darmo;
  • Imagify – profile aggressive/ultra; typowe oszczędności 63–80%; świetne do WordPress;
  • FreeConvert – automatycznie łączy kompresję stratną i progresywną; zgodne z rekomendacjami Google;
  • Inne – Image Recycle (mocny przy dużych JPG), Toolur (5 metod stratnych + zmiana rozmiaru), CompressNow (prosty, może konwertować PNG/GIF do JPG).

W testach skuteczności ShortPixel (tryb Lossy) osiągał 58–86% oszczędności na JPG/PNG/GIF, a Image Recycle wyróżniał się przy bardzo dużych plikach JPG.

Oprogramowanie desktopowe i wbudowane

Gdy wolisz pracę lokalnie lub potrzebujesz większej kontroli nad parametrami, skorzystaj z tych aplikacji:

  • Adobe Photoshop – eksport z jakością 70–85% (Zapisz dla WWW) oraz redukcja rozmiaru w pikselach (Obraz > Rozmiar obrazu);
  • Caesium – darmowy kompresor JPG/PNG z obsługą przetwarzania wsadowego;
  • Paint (Windows) – szybka zmiana rozdzielczości i podstawowa kompresja (Otwórz > Zmień rozmiar);
  • CapCut – prosta kompresja z presetami jakości i rozmiaru.

WordPress: wtyczki ShortPixel, Imagify lub Smush automatycznie kompresują uploadowane JPG i potrafią dociążyć starsze biblioteki.

Praktyczne wskazówki – krok po kroku jak skompresować JPG

Aby uzyskać świetne efekty przy minimalnym wysiłku, postępuj według poniższych kroków:

  1. Wybierz narzędzie – do szybkiej pracy użyj Compressor.io lub TinyJPG, do masowej – ShortPixel;
  2. Ustaw parametry – jakość 70–85%, włącz tryb progresywny, ustaw próbkowanie 4:2:0;
  3. Zmniejsz rozdzielczość – nie przekraczaj realnych potrzeb (np. szerokość 1920 px dla web);
  4. Przetwarzanie wsadowe – kompresuj w paczkach i porównuj wersje przed/po;
  5. Testuj – sprawdzaj efekt wizualny oraz metryki w PageSpeed Insights i Lighthouse;
  6. Automatyzacja – skorzystaj z API (np. Kraken) lub wtyczek CMS.

Przykład: plik JPG 5 MB po kompresji ShortPixel może spaść do ok. 500 KB przy jakości nieodróżnialnej dla większości użytkowników.

Potencjalne pułapki i dobre praktyki

Aby uniknąć artefaktów i problemów z kompatybilnością, zwróć uwagę na kluczowe zasady:

  • unikaj nadmiernej kompresji – zejście poniżej ~60% jakości zwykle skutkuje blokowaniem i rozmyciami;
  • zachowuj metadane (EXIF), jeśli są potrzebne – niektóre narzędzia (np. Kraken) pozwalają selektywnie usuwać lub zostawiać EXIF;
  • używaj lazy loading i atrybutu srcset – serwuj obrazy w rozmiarze dopasowanym do urządzenia i ładuj je dopiero, gdy są potrzebne;
  • testuj w różnych przeglądarkach – wsparcie WebP/AVIF jest szerokie w 2026 roku, ale zawsze weryfikuj zgodność;
  • rób kopie zapasowe oryginałów – ułatwia to ponowną kompresję z innymi parametrami bez utraty jakości źródła.
Marta Doruch

Absolwentka Informatyki Stosowanej na Politechnice Warszawskiej oraz Finansów w Szkole Głównej Handlowej. Doświadczenie zdobywała, wdrażając rozwiązania chmurowe OpenStack i AWS dla fintechów w Londynie i Zurychu, by obecnie łączyć świat technologii z biznesem jako konsultantka IT w Warszawie. Pasjonatka rynku nieruchomości i inwestorka, która po godzinach testuje nowinki Smart Home i pisze o wpływie sztucznej inteligencji na współczesną edukację.